TUNGNATH
RUDRANATH TOUR |
 |
| The
sanctity of the region of Tungath is
considered unsurpassed. The peak of
Tungnath is the source of three springs
that from the river Akashkamini. At this
temple at 3,680 mts, Shiva's arm is
worshipped. The highest hindu shrine in
the Himalayas, 3kms uphill from Chopta,
Tungath is reached through a path that
wends through alpine meadows and
rhododendron thickets. An hour's climb
from here leads to Chandrashila with its
panoromic views. The entire journey and
the shrine are located in some of the
finest, most picturesque pocket of the
Himalaya. |
| Devotees
come to Rudranath to offer ritual
obeisance ti their ancestors, for it is
here, at Vaitarani river that the soal
of dead cross when entering another
world. The temple of Rudranath at 2,286
mts, entails trekking through ridges at
almost twice that height before reaching
the meadow where it is located. Within
the sanctum, Shiva's image is worshipped
in the form of his face. The temple is
surround by several pools - Surya Kund,
Chandra Kund, Tara Kund, Manas Kund -
while the great peaks of Nanda Devi,
Trishul and Nanda Ghunti rear overhead. |
